当前位置: 首页 > 后端技术 > Node.js

构建工具

时间:2023-04-03 18:35:40 Node.js

Vue首屏加载优化关于Vue首屏加载优化的小总结为什么要做三个Webpack配置文件知乎上经常看到同学提问:BAT等大型前端工程化如何网站有组织吗?这确实是一个非常广泛的问答,可能会有分歧。我觉得如果要回答这个问题,还是从Webpack的配置说起比较好。如今,Webpack已经成为前端工程必备的基础工具之一。它不仅在前端工程中被广泛使用...再见,babel-preset-2015babel官网在9月份公布了ES20xx时代的ES2015/ES2016/ES2017等presets全部弃用,转而支持babel-preset-env,这有望成为“面向未来”的解决方案。[[vscode]快速更新package.json中的依赖版本](https://juejin.im/entry/593e5...求助节点依赖保持强迫症患者缓解症状的绿色良药教你如何从零开始写一个简单的VUE今天给大家带来的是实现一个简单的类似于VUE的前端框架,VUE框架应该算是非常主流的前端数据驱动框架了,今天我们就来写一个非常简单的VUE框架从无到有,主要是让大家了解vue的核心部分是如何工作的。包括数据绑定、模板处理、页面渲染、数据驱动视图等部分快速创建简单高效的webpack配置webpack带来了毋庸置疑的改变对前端开发来说,它把JS、图片、css作为模块来处理,开发方便、自动化、兼容AMD写法等很多优点就不用多说了,更难能可贵的是它的插件化incommunity非常强大,适合不同的业务需求和技术需求。社区中有大量可用的插件。凡事都有两面,很多人说:前端开发不再是...npm入门教程Node.js的出现,让编写服务端应用成为可能。Node.js是用C++编写的,基于V8引擎构建,因此运行速度非常快。一开始,Node.js只是想运行在服务端环境,但开发者显然不满足于此,开始创造各种工具来自动化任务。正因为如此,基于Node的前端自动化工具(如Grunt、Gulp、Webpack)的出现也给前端开发带来了翻天覆地的变化。本文最后更新于08.06.2017,其中包括npm的当前状态和npm5的一些变化。Jenkins实现了前端项目的自动化集成、打包和部署。以前在写前端项目打包部署的时候,都是手动运行命令,打包之后,然后压缩,然后上传到服务器解压。这种方法确实有点low,效率不高。自从用了Jenkins持续集成工具,写前端项目越来越工程化了。再也不用担心忘记部署项目,也不用担心每次打包压缩后都要部署多个服务器和环境。让我更开心的是,每次回家...webpack-dev-server中inline和HMR的区别提供webpack打包Web服务生成的资源文件。它还有一个静态资源文件指纹连接到我们...Webpack通过Socket.IO这篇文章解释了如何在webpack中为静态资源添加哈希值:每次构建过程都会产生一个新的哈希值,所以它一般用于版本控制;chunkhash是根据内容生成的,但是webpack把所有类型的文件都打包成一个bundle,以js为聚合点,改变css也会导致整个js的hash改变。。。前端图片预览经常有图片上传的功能需求,如果我们先把图片上传到服务器,然后在前端显示返回的结果,这样的操作性能开销太大了。画面太多,差点哭了。删除,那简直是不可想象的。所以我们需要先在前端显示图片,然后让用户确认没有问题,再统一上传。无论是运维还是移动研发,GIT都是绕不开的事情。当然,如果你说要用SVN,那不在本次讨论范围之内。话不多说,请看下面的GIT图分析,10分钟学会git操作,当然后面的教程主要是实战为主,会和你在其他网站看到的不一样。webpack新手必知事项关于微信公众号:前端呼啦圈(Love-FED)我的博客:Raub的博客知乎专栏:前端呼啦圈前言这是我介绍webpack的第一篇文章。先从入门教程开始吧,后面会陆续推出更多webpack相关的文章。首先什么是webpack?如果是打包工具,真的有点大材小用了。...在GitHub上共享Fun,入门级开源项目,过去在GitHub上托管其所有内容,现在用Flask编写此站点。查看、推荐项目、编辑和分发终于可以编程了?webpack中的hash和chunkhash是不是很熟悉?后者很好理解,因为webpack中chunk的意思就是一个模块,那么chunkhash顾名思义就是模块内容计算出来的hash值。在这里我们不得不问另一个问题。比如vue这样的框架把js和css放在一起的时候,我们通常在vue-cli的webpack配置编辑模式下使用一个叫extract-text-webpack-...的插件显示是正常的,但是我不知道为什么一打开就出现排版问题。segementfalut链接在这里版本号vue-cli2.8.1(终端可以通过vue-V查看)vue2.2.2webpack2.2.1目录结构├──README.md├──build│├──...webpack插件精选(一)——webpack-dev-server你可能会花30分钟阅读本章,掌握webpack-dev-server的使用,理清一些容易混淆的配置(如publicPath)或概念(如HMR)...稍微了解一下webpack的CommonsChunkPlugin你好~亲爱的读者们~最近在学习webpack。曾几何时,总觉得webpack系统庞大,难以掌握,一直避而不学。然而,伟人鲁迅曾说过:世界上太多的东西,会因为你无法掌握而使你狂躁不安。最好的解决办法是硬着头皮开始做!于是我从比较简单的Com...VueJS开发FAQ合集公司前端开始转向VueJS以来,最近开始使用这个框架进行开发,记录下遇到的一些问题,以备日后使用。主要写一些官方手册上没有写,但是在实际开发中会遇到的问题,需要一定的知识基础。CLI:Vue-CLIUI:ElementHTML:Pug(Jade)CSS:Les...vue-cli自定义路径别名assets和静态文件夹的区别--save-dev和--save的区别这是一个vue-cli几个小知识点的简单介绍,适合刚接触vue-cli脚手架,不太了解的同学,大佬绕道。有需要的朋友可以做个参考,喜欢的话可以点个赞,或者关注一下,希望对大家有所帮助。相信很多人都知道vue-cli有两个地方可以放置静态资源,分别是src/asse...webpack:从入门到真正的项目配置。自从模块化出现后,可以把原来的一大堆代码拆分成一个个模块,但这就带来了一个问题。每个JS文件都需要从服务器获取,这使得加载速度较慢。Webpack的主要目的是通过将所有小文件打包成一个或多个大文件来解决这个问题。官网上的图片很好的说明了这件事。另外,Web...webpack从入门到工程实践初衷是想和大家理清webpack的使用逻辑,方便自己编写和扩展自己项目所需的配置文件。但是,必须提前声明,这篇文章可能不是一个很好的教程,可以跟随(如果你想一步一步跟着,你可以看官方的例子(https://webpack.js.org/guides/)和webpack介绍,看这里这篇文章就够了(http://www.jianshu.com/p/42e1...)。想看看这些有趣的函数方法吗?前言这是underscore.js的第六篇文章源码分析,如果你对这个系列感兴趣,请点击underscore-analysis/watch,随时看动态更新,underscore里面有很多有趣的方法,可以解决我们遇到的问题在我们日常生活中以更巧妙的方式,比如_.after,_.be...webpack-dev-middleware详解webpack专题阅读前端中文文档,印中文就对了,中文最权威开发文档Vue/React/Webpack/PostCSS...我们还在整合社区资源,配合官方为中文社区的开发者提供最新最可靠的中文开发文档,欢迎有能力的同学加入我们一起翻译和翻译校对文件。Node命令行翻译工具Node翻译工具,友好帮助解决开发中遇到的英文错误问题。记一个基于vue-cli打包优化的webpack打包优化改造